Position Description:
The Department Head will provide creative and dynamic leadership to initiate and implement programs appropriate to education initiatives in the Department of Educational Leadership including a doctoral program, masters and certificate programs in both Educational Administration and Higher Education as well as masters programs in Educational Technology and Training and Development; recommend and supervise partnership contracts with community and state agencies, assist in the development of departmental grants; supervise the budget, personnel, and general operation of the department; represent the department on the College of Education Executive Council; and work in a collegial manner with faculty and staff. The faculty will consist of approximately 24 individuals of professorial rank.
